How To Fix PLM_AUDIT_APPL082 - The value &1 &2 was initialized by the system


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: PLM_AUDIT_APPL - Audit Application

  • Message number: 082

  • Message text: The value &1 &2 was initialized by the system

    The SAP error message PLM_AUDIT_APPL082 indicates that a specific value (represented by placeholders &1 and &2) was initialized by the system, which typically means that the system has set a default value for a field or parameter that is not being populated correctly by the user or the system process.
    
    Cause: Default Initialization: The system may have default values for certain fields that are not being overridden by user input or other processes. Missing Data: The required data might not be available or correctly configured in the system, leading to the system using its default values.
    Configuration Issues: There may be issues with the configuration of the application or module that is causing the system to initialize values incorrectly. User Input Error: The user may not have provided the necessary input, leading the system to use its default values.
